FDA Approves First-in-Human Trial for New Targeted Cancer Therapy
Vivos Inc. has received FDA approval to commence a first-in-human clinical feasibility study in the U.S. for its innovative RadioGel® therapy. This yttrium-90-based injectable hydrogel aims to provide targeted treatment for cancerous tumors. The initial study will focus on assessing the safety and feasibility of the treatment in patients with non-resectable papillary thyroid carcinoma at Mayo Clinic.
